Meryl Streep and Goldie Hawn on Jimmy Kimmel Live : what to expect
Goldie Hawn stops by on Wednesday, April 29, promoting her children's project The After-School Kindness Crew. The actress and producer, who has been a fixture in Hollywood since the late 1960s, rarely makes TV appearances these days — which makes this one worth noting. She'll share the couch with Asif Ali and Saagar Shaikh, who are promoting their comedy series Deli Boys, and the night wraps up with a live performance by Duran Duran featuring Nile Rodgers. Not a bad Wednesday.
Then comes Thursday, April 30, with Meryl Streep — and the reason for her visit is significant. She's there to talk about The Devil Wears Prada 2, the long-awaited sequel to the 2006 fashion world satire that became a cultural milestone. Streep, a three-time Academy Award winner, doesn't do late-night often. Her appearance alongside Desi Lydic, correspondent on The Daily Show, rounds out what shapes up to be one of the stronger episodes of the season. For anyone tracking where to watch content tied to these projects, Jimmy Kimmel Live airs every weeknight at 11 :35 p.m. ET on ABC, then streams the following day on Hulu and Hulu on Disney+.

Why these appearances matter beyond the talk-show moment
Streep promoting The Devil Wears Prada 2 on late-night TV signals something broader : major studios are betting on legacy sequels to capture both nostalgic audiences and new viewers discovering titles through streaming platforms. The original film pulled in over $326 million at the worldwide box office back in 2006 — a number that, adjusted for inflation, makes the sequel one of the more commercially anticipated projects of the year.
Goldie Hawn's involvement with The After-School Kindness Crew reflects a different side of her career. Through her nonprofit foundation MindUP, which she launched in 2003, Hawn has long advocated for children's mental health and social-emotional learning. This project fits squarely into that mission, giving her appearance on Kimmel a purpose beyond simple promotion.
